卖逼视频免费看片|狼人就干网中文字慕|成人av影院导航|人妻少妇精品无码专区二区妖婧|亚洲丝袜视频玖玖|一区二区免费中文|日本高清无码一区|国产91无码小说|国产黄片子视频91sese日韩|免费高清无码成人网站入口

Python中的logging模塊使用方法詳解

在學(xué)習(xí)Python編程過(guò)程中,熟練掌握l(shuí)ogging模塊的使用對(duì)于程序員來(lái)說(shuō)至關(guān)重要。本文將詳細(xì)介紹如何在Python中正確地利用logging模塊記錄和處理錯(cuò)誤信息,以提高代碼的可靠性和可維護(hù)性。

在學(xué)習(xí)Python編程過(guò)程中,熟練掌握l(shuí)ogging模塊的使用對(duì)于程序員來(lái)說(shuō)至關(guān)重要。本文將詳細(xì)介紹如何在Python中正確地利用logging模塊記錄和處理錯(cuò)誤信息,以提高代碼的可靠性和可維護(hù)性。

打開(kāi)pycharm編輯器導(dǎo)入logging模塊

首先,打開(kāi)您的Python集成開(kāi)發(fā)環(huán)境(IDE)——比如常用的pycharm,在新建的Python文件中導(dǎo)入logging模塊。通過(guò)簡(jiǎn)單的幾行代碼,即可輕松實(shí)現(xiàn)導(dǎo)入操作,保證后續(xù)的代碼順利執(zhí)行。

編寫(xiě)包含錯(cuò)誤的函數(shù)并使用try語(yǔ)句檢測(cè)

在編輯器中新建一個(gè)名為main的函數(shù),并故意在其中引入一個(gè)錯(cuò)誤,比如嘗試執(zhí)行一個(gè)除零操作(10/0)。接著使用try語(yǔ)句對(duì)main函數(shù)進(jìn)行檢測(cè),確保程序能夠正常運(yùn)行且在出現(xiàn)異常時(shí)能夠進(jìn)行處理。

通過(guò)logging模塊記錄錯(cuò)誤信息

當(dāng)程序執(zhí)行過(guò)程中出現(xiàn)錯(cuò)誤時(shí),我們需要及時(shí)捕獲并記錄相關(guān)信息以便后續(xù)排查。通過(guò)logging模塊,可以方便地將錯(cuò)誤信息輸出到控制臺(tái)或日志文件中,幫助開(kāi)發(fā)者快速定位問(wèn)題所在,并進(jìn)行修復(fù)。

程序繼續(xù)執(zhí)行并觀察結(jié)果

雖然在程序中出現(xiàn)了錯(cuò)誤,但在使用logging模塊記錄錯(cuò)誤信息后,后續(xù)的代碼仍會(huì)繼續(xù)執(zhí)行。在錯(cuò)誤信息被打印出來(lái)之后,我們可以繼續(xù)觀察程序的執(zhí)行情況,以確保整體功能的完整性和穩(wěn)定性。

運(yùn)行程序并查看控制臺(tái)輸出

最后,在完成以上步驟后,點(diǎn)擊編輯器頂部的運(yùn)行命令,選擇要執(zhí)行的Python文件。在控制臺(tái)中,您將看到已經(jīng)記錄的錯(cuò)誤信息以及程序繼續(xù)執(zhí)行的結(jié)果,這有助于全面了解程序的執(zhí)行流程和可能存在的問(wèn)題。

通過(guò)本文對(duì)Python中l(wèi)ogging模塊的詳細(xì)介紹和實(shí)際操作演示,相信讀者對(duì)如何正確使用logging模塊有了更清晰的認(rèn)識(shí)。合理地利用logging模塊可以提高代碼的健壯性和可維護(hù)性,為日后的編程工作奠定堅(jiān)實(shí)基礎(chǔ)。

標(biāo)簽: